Tamara Djurickovic 52 minutes ago Share Share Send email Copy link Invest Europe has published its latest report, Transaction Value: Private Capital Analysis , examining private capital investment across Europe in 2025.

The report shows that venture capital recorded its second-highest transaction value on record, growth capital recovered after three consecutive years of decline, and buyout activity remained broadly stable. Across the market, European private capital proved resilient despite continued macroeconomic and geopolitical uncertainty, with transaction value remaining above €260 billion for the second consecutive year. The findings also point to continued investment concentration in technology and healthcare, reflecting sustained investor interest in innovation-led sectors.

The report analyses investment activity by stage, region, sector and transaction size, while also examining equity ratios, co-investment trends and financing structures. Together, the findings provide an overview of how private capital is being deployed across European markets and the sectors and regions attracting the highest levels of investment.
